Anemone is a psychedelic pop quintet, styled "ANEMONE" and mispronounced, [1] which formed in Montreal, Quebec in September 2015. [2] Named after the song " Anemone" by The Brian Jonestown Massacre, it is fronted by the pianist and singer Chloé Soldevila, a Montreal native with classical training in the flute and piano. The band's compositions feature both baroque [3] influences and counter melody.
Their line-up was Soldevila, drummer Miles Dupire-Gagnon (also of Elephant Stone), guitarist Gabriel Lambert, bass guitarist Samuel Gemme, and guitarist and backing vocalist Zach Irving, who left the band in 2020. [4] [5] They have been called Montreal's best new psych band, [6] and topped Paste magazine's list of the ten bands they were most excited to see at the 2019 Treefort Music Fest in Boise, Idaho, [7] as well as being second on Inlander's must-see list. [8][ citation needed]
In 2018, Anemone released the EP Baby Only You & I. [9] In 2019, they released their debut album Beat My Distance, which received luke-warm reviews. [10] [11] However, also in 2019, they received a SOCAN Songwriting Prize nomination for the song "She's the One". [12] [13]
